Kirishima-Jingū (霧島神宮?) is a Shinto shrine located in Kirishima, Kagoshima prefecture, Japan. It is dedicated to Konohanasakuya-hime, Hoori, Toyotama-hime, Ugayafukiaezu and Tamayori-bime. This shrine holds several Important Cultural Properties, such as HondenHeidenHaiden (本殿・幣殿・拝殿), Tōrōka (登廊下), Chōkushiden (勅使殿) etc. It has been destroyed several times by volcanic eruptions.[1]
